The international network of researchers, that produce high quality literature reviews, has found ‘high-certainty’ evidence in support of vaping for smoking cessation.
Cochrane is a registered not-for-profit organisation, with a global independent network of members from over 190 countries that gathers and summarises evidence from research to help make people make informed decisions about their health.
The Cochrane Library summarises and interprets scientific and medical research to produce reviews and meta-analyses of key scientific questions that are considered the ‘gold standard’ in the medical profession. The review, which is aimed at examining the effectiveness, admissibility, and safety of e-cigarettes to help those who smoke quit, includes 78 studies representing 22,052 participants. Forty of those studies are randomised control trials.
Key findings and conclusions from the Cochrane Review are summarised below:
- There is ‘high-certainty evidence’ that nicotine-containing e-cigarettes increase the chance of an adult smoker achieving long-term cessation compared to traditional Nicotine Replacement Therapy’s (NRT) – such as the use of nicotine patches or gums.
- Per 100 people who attempt to quit, e-cigarettes may be expected to yield an additional four quitters compared to traditional NRT users.
- Evidence also suggests that nicotine e-cigarettes may benefit someone attempting to quit smoking better than behavioural support, although the researchers concluded it is less certain.
- Researchers did not detect evidence of ‘serious harm’ from e-cigarettes.

Cochrane’s concrete findings follow several recent reviews in the UK2, Canada3 and New Zealand4 of the harms of e-cigarettes, with each showing clear evidence that vaping poses only a small fraction of the health risks of smoking. Taken altogether, these reports should provide reassurance to adult smokers that e-cigarettes are a better alternative and can increase your chances of quitting traditional smoking. Plus, by not burning tobacco, e-cigarettes do not expose users to the same complex mix of chemicals as conventional combustible cigarettes do.
